/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.messages{padding:15px 20px 15px 35px;word-wrap:break-word;border:1px solid;border-width:1px 1px 1px 0;border-radius:2px;background:no-repeat 10px 17px;overflow-wrap:break-word;}[dir="rtl"] .messages{padding-right:35px;padding-left:20px;text-align:right;border-width:1px 0 1px 1px;background-position:right 10px top 17px;}.messages + .messages{margin-top:1.538em;}.messages__list{margin:0;padding:0;list-style:none;}.messages__item + .messages__item{margin-top:0.769em;}.messages--status{color:#325e1c;border-color:#c9e1bd #c9e1bd #c9e1bd transparent;background-color:#f3faef;background-image:url(/themes/contrib/classy/images/icons/73b355/check.svg);box-shadow:-8px 0 0 #77b259;}[dir="rtl"] .messages--status{margin-left:0;border-color:#c9e1bd transparent #c9e1bd #c9e1bd;box-shadow:8px 0 0 #77b259;}.messages--warning{color:#734c00;border-color:#f4daa6 #f4daa6 #f4daa6 transparent;background-color:#fdf8ed;background-image:url(/themes/contrib/classy/images/icons/e29700/warning.svg);box-shadow:-8px 0 0 #e09600;}[dir="rtl"] .messages--warning{border-color:#f4daa6 transparent #f4daa6 #f4daa6;box-shadow:8px 0 0 #e09600;}.messages--error{color:#a51b00;border-color:#f9c9bf #f9c9bf #f9c9bf transparent;background-color:#fcf4f2;background-image:url(/themes/contrib/classy/images/icons/e32700/error.svg);box-shadow:-8px 0 0 #e62600;}[dir="rtl"] .messages--error{border-color:#f9c9bf transparent #f9c9bf #f9c9bf;box-shadow:8px 0 0 #e62600;}.messages--error p.error{color:#a51b00;}
@font-face{font-display:fallback;font-family:Open Sans;font-style:normal;font-weight:400;src:url(/themes/custom/alliant/assets/fonts/a1535f451fb7bb98f526.woff2) format("woff2"),url(/themes/custom/alliant/assets/fonts/7958f4e4a2bb8025ef86.woff) format("woff")}@font-face{font-display:fallback;font-family:Open Sans;font-style:normal;font-weight:700;src:url(/themes/custom/alliant/assets/fonts/b245bc85ddeedb27a549.woff2) format("woff2"),url(/themes/custom/alliant/assets/fonts/2867e720135399c4b665.woff) format("woff")}*{-webkit-box-sizing:border-box;box-sizing:border-box}body{font-family:Open Sans,system-ui,-apple-system,blinkmacsystemfont,Segoe UI,Ubuntu,Roboto,Noto Sans,Droid Sans,sans-serif;font-size:100%;max-width:100%;overflow-x:hidden;position:relative}body,figure,ol,ul{margin:0}ol,ul{list-style:none;padding:0}p{line-height:1.5625rem;margin-bottom:0;margin-top:0}p a{overflow-wrap:break-word}blockquote{margin:0}h1,h2,h3,h4,h5,h6{margin-bottom:0;margin-top:0}@media(max-width:74.9375rem){h1{font-size:2rem;line-height:2.5rem}}@media(min-width:75rem){h1{font-size:3rem;line-height:3.5rem}}@media(max-width:74.9375rem){h2{font-size:1.375rem;line-height:1.625rem}}@media(min-width:75rem){h2{font-size:1.8125rem;line-height:2.25rem}}@media(max-width:74.9375rem){h3{font-size:1rem;line-height:1.375rem}}@media(min-width:75rem){h3{font-size:1.375rem;line-height:1.625rem}}h4{font-size:1.125rem}h4,h5{font-weight:700;margin-bottom:1.5rem}h5{font-size:.875rem}img{display:block}@media(-ms-high-contrast:active),(-ms-high-contrast:none){img{border:none}}a{color:#102c52}@media(min-width:75rem){a:not(.button):not(.menu__link):not(.tab-title):not([name]):not([data-lightbox]):hover{opacity:.6}}iframe{border:none}.video-embed-field-lazy-play{border:0}.u-no-scroll{height:100vh;overflow:hidden}@media(max-width:74.9375rem){.u-no-scroll.mobile--ios{position:fixed}}.disabled{pointer-events:none}.clearfix:after{clear:both;content:"";display:table}@media(max-width:47.9375rem){.hide--mobile{display:none}}@media(min-width:48rem)and (max-width:74.9375rem){.hide--tablet{display:none}}@media(min-width:75rem){.hide--desktop{display:none}}
.block--header-buttons .button,.button{border-radius:7px;border-style:solid;border-width:.125rem;color:#102c52;white-space:nowrap}.button--step-back{border:0}.block--header-buttons .button--request-info{background-color:#102c52;border-color:#102c52;color:#fff}.block--rfi-button .button--request{background-color:#102c52;color:#fff}.form-submit.button--next,.form-submit.button--submit{color:#fff}@media(min-width:75rem){.paragraph--tabs-block .paragraph__nav-list{-webkit-box-pack:center;-ms-flex-pack:center;-webkit-column-gap:1rem;-moz-column-gap:1rem;column-gap:1rem;display:-webkit-box;display:flexbox;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;justify-content:center;margin-left:auto;margin-right:auto;max-width:62rem;row-gap:1rem}}.paragraph--tabs-block .paragraph__nav-list .tab-title{font-size:.625rem;line-height:.8125rem;text-decoration:none;text-transform:uppercase}@media(max-width:74.9375rem){.paragraph--tabs-block .paragraph__nav-list .tab-title{display:block;padding:.5rem 1rem}.paragraph--tabs-block .paragraph__nav-list .tab-title:not(:last-of-type){margin-bottom:.25rem}}@media(min-width:75rem){.paragraph--tabs-block .paragraph__nav-list .tab-title{padding:1.25rem;white-space:nowrap}}.paragraph--tabs-block .paragraph__nav-list .tab-title:not(.is-active){color:#484b50}@media(min-width:75rem){.paragraph--tabs-block .paragraph__nav-list .tab-title:not(.is-active){background-color:#f4f4f4}}.paragraph--tabs-block .paragraph__nav-list .tab-title.is-active{background-color:#d3701b}@media(min-width:75rem){.paragraph--tabs-block .paragraph__nav-list .tab-title:hover{text-decoration:underline}}.paragraph--table-of-content{background-color:#f4f4f4;margin-bottom:1.5rem}@media(min-width:75rem){.paragraph--table-of-content{padding:2rem 1.5rem 2rem 0;position:relative}.paragraph--table-of-content:before{background-color:#f4f4f4;bottom:0;content:"";position:absolute;right:100%;top:0;width:50vw}.region--footer-first{background-color:#f4f4f4}}.form:not(.form--search) .form-item--title{color:#102c52;margin-bottom:1.5rem}.view--faculty-list .view-filters{background-color:#00b5e2}.paragraph--posts-featured{background-color:#f4f4f4}.paragraph--posts-all-categories{border:.125rem solid #102c52}@media screen and (max-width:1199px){.progress-step:not(:last-child):after{display:none}.hero--webform__wrap{background-color:#fff;margin-left:-20px;margin-right:-20px;margin-top:20px;padding:10px}.hero--webform__wrap .progress-tracker{-webkit-box-direction:normal;-webkit-box-orient:horizontal;-ms-flex-direction:inherit;flex-direction:inherit;flex-direction:row;row-gap:1rem}.paragraph--hero-media .paragraph__content{display:block}}@media screen and (min-width:1200px){.page--front .media--type-image.media--view-mode-default{display:none}.hero--webform__wrap{background-color:#fff;padding:20px;width:35%}.hero--webform__wrap .form:not(.form--search)>.form-wrapper:not(.form-actions){display:block}.paragraph--hero-media .paragraph__content{-webkit-box-align:center;-ms-flex-align:center;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-box-pack:center;-ms-flex-pack:center;align-items:center;bottom:unset;-ms-flex-direction:row;flex-direction:row;justify-content:center;margin:auto;max-width:1200px;min-height:510px;position:static;top:0;-webkit-transform:unset;transform:unset;width:100%}.paragraph--hero-media .paragraph__content__subwrap .form-search{width:100%}.paragraph__content__subwrap{padding-right:1rem;width:60%}.paragraph--hero-media .media{height:auto}.form:not(.form--search) .form-actions{margin-top:15px}.paragraph--hero-media{background:#102c52;height:auto;left:50%;min-width:100vw;padding-bottom:165px;-webkit-transform:translateX(-50%);transform:translateX(-50%)}.page--front .block--request-information.block{display:none}.paragraph--hero-media .lines{z-index:-1!important}}.webform-button--submit.js-form-submit{padding:0!important;width:0!important}@media(min-width:767px)and (max-width:1200px){.hero__text-content{padding-right:0}.paragraph--hero-media .paragraph__content{display:-webkit-box;display:-ms-flexbox;display:flex}.hero--webform .hero__text-content,.hero--webform__wrap{-ms-flex-item-align:center;align-self:center;width:90%}}@media only screen and (max-width:74.9375rem){.progress-tracker{-webkit-box-orient:horizontal!important;-webkit-box-direction:normal!important;-ms-flex-direction:row!important;flex-direction:row!important}}@media only screen and (max-width:1199px){.menu--responsive .menu__item--expanded{position:relative}.menu--responsive .menu__item:not(:last-of-type) .menu__link--submenu-trigger{border-bottom:none}li[class^=liveagent_button_online]{display:list-item!important}li.menu__item.menu__item--expanded{overflow-y:visible!important}}.floating-image-promo.no-parent-link,.floating-img-banner.no-parent-link,.floatingImgBanner.no-parent-link,a:has(.floatingImgBanner,.floating-img-banner,.floating-image-promo){float:right;max-width:300px!important;padding-bottom:30px;padding-left:30px}@media only screen and (max-width:767px){.floating-image-promo.no-parent-link,.floating-img-banner.no-parent-link,.floatingImgBanner.no-parent-link,a:has(.floatingImgBanner,.floating-img-banner,.floating-image-promo){float:none;margin-bottom:25px;max-width:100%!important;padding:0}}
.icon--health{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_SNHS.png);background-size:100%;}.icon--psychology{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_CSPP.png);background-size:100%;}.icon--education{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_CSOE.png);background-size:100%;}.icon--business{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_CSML.png);background-size:100%;}.icon--forensics{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_CSFS.png);background-size:100%;}.icon--law{background-image:url(/themes/custom/alliant/pdm/images/Webiste-Icons_5_SFLS.png);background-size:100%;}
